Choosing
a Career
Choosing
a career can be difficult and most people can
expect to change careers several times during
their working lives. Here are some steps that can
help ensure your choices are good ones.
Start with your values.
Decide
what's really important to you. What gets you
excited?
Determine your skills and
talents.
You
are more likely to enjoy doing something you are
naturally good at.
Determine your preferences.
People
like to work in certain ways and in certain types
of environments. Knowing your preferences helps
determine what kind of work you will find
interesting and challenging. Taking the
Myers-Briggs Type self assesment indicator can
help you figure this out clearly.
Get experience in the career
feild.
A
career often looks different to those doing it
than to those who are not. Get the inside scoop
by talking to people who are actually doing the
job. Consider taking a test drive by doing some
volunteer, temp, or part-time work in the feild.
Invest time and energy into
furthering your career.
Devote
an hour a week to something that is
developmental. Dedicate yourself to getting ahead
and taking control of your future.
